Martins Hill Lane is in Burton, Christchurch and in Christchurch district. BH23 7JF is located in the Burton & Grange elect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Christchurch.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Martins Hill Lane Street dangerous?

In 2023, 29 crimes were reported near Martins Hill Lane . 76%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ered very saf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of BH23 7JF.
